Linux部署教程,把vscode放在网页上运行,随时随地编写代码

发布网友 发布时间:2024-10-23 21:59

我来回答

1个回答

热心网友 时间:2024-11-09 22:35

借助Linux系统与Docker技术,将Visual Studio Code(VSCode)部署在云端,实现代码编辑的随时随地进行,摆脱了对物理设备的依赖。作为开源且功能强大的集成开发环境(IDE),VSCode以其简洁的界面和丰富的插件支持,成为了许多开发者的首选工具。然而,如何在无需实体电脑的情况下,持续进行代码编写与调试呢?答案是利用Docker容器化技术,将VSCode的Web版本运行于Linux服务器上。

首先,确保已安装Docker,这是在Linux系统中运行Docker容器所必需的软件。在CentOS 7或Ubuntu系统上,可以通过执行`sudo yum install docker`或`sudo apt-get install docker`命令进行安装。

接下来,通过运行以下命令拉取并启动VSCode Web版本的Docker镜像:`sudo docker run -d -p 9090:80 --restart always --name=vscode_web vscode/webvscode`。这里的关键参数解释如下:`-d`表示在后台运行容器并返回容器ID,`-p`用于将宿主机的端口映射到容器内部,使得外部可以访问容器内的服务,`--restart always`确保容器在重启时自动运行镜像,而`--name`则是为容器服务命名。

若操作成功,将能够通过`ip:9090`(其中`ip`为Linux服务器的IP地址)访问VSCode Web服务,实现代码编辑的移动化。不论是在手机、平板还是其他电脑上,只要有网络连接,便能通过浏览器访问该服务,进行代码的编写、调试与协作。

配置与优化方面,下期内容将深入探讨VSCode Web服务的个性化设置与效能提升策略。在享受无束缚编程体验的同时,请注意网络环境的安全性与稳定性,确保数据安全与服务的高效运行。

声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com